MiciMike drop-in replacement circuit board for the first-generation Google Home Mini crowdfunding campaign has already gotten over 1000% funding with more than 2-weeks left to go

https://www.crowdsupply.com/micimike-rev-devices/micimike-home-mini-drop-in-pcb

The concept is make it simple to partially reuse and convert the shell of a Google Home Mini into a fully open-source and local-only Home Assistant voice smart speaker compatible device. The project is a community highlight mentioned in the latest Open Home Foundation newsletter

https://newsletter.openhomefoundation.org/research-as-an-antidote-to-software-brain/

It is expensive and very niche but nice solution for those who want to keep the exact same aesthetic, and can do a stealth upgrade of its internals without others in the family seeing a difference on the outside
